Ophthalmic Nurse

The Ophthalmic Nurse works on prevention, diagnosis, and treatment of eye injuries or diseases such as cataracts and glaucoma. Responsibilities include vision testing, surgical assistance, medication administration, patient education, clinic maintenance, and medical record management.
Responsibilities
- Conduct vision tests (visual acuity, tension)
- Register patient medical histories
- Assist surgical team during eye surgery
- Instruct patients on eye injury care at home
- Administer medications and use medical equipment
- Supervise daily clinic cleaning
- Prepare outpatient paperwork (prescriptions, histories)
- Measure VA, IOP, vital signs
- Perform minor surgeries
- Assist in major scrub procedures
- Carry out sterilization tasks
- Support ophthalmic doctors and optometrists
- Organize patient files and register cards
